A cable tray terminal serves as the endpoint of a cable tray system, providing a secure and organized way to manage cables as they exit the tray or connect to equipment, junction boxes, or other electrical enclosures. It ensures that cables are properly supported, protected from mechanical stress, and routed safely without sharp bends or damage, maintaining compliance with electrical codes and safety standards (NEC Article 392.2) .
